Prevalence and associated factors of pregnancy induced hypertension among pregnant women in public hospitals of Hadiya Zone, Central Ethiopia: A cross-sectional study

PLoS ONE Zerfework Debebe Argago, Nebiyu Dereje, Neena Elezebeth Philip Aug 01, 2025 DOI: 10.1371/journal.pone.0326236

Background Pregnancy-induced hypertension is one of the global public health burdens contributing to several adverse perinatal outcomes. However, data on the prevalence and associated factors of PIH is limited in Hadiya Zone, central Ethiopia. Methods We conducted a cross-sectional study among women attending antenatal care in the four public hospitals in the Hadiya zone from August 1, 2023, to January 30, 2024. The total sample size (433) was proportionally allocated to each hospital. Data were collected by face-to-face interview using a structured questionnaire. Blood pressure was measured by a digital Sphygmomanometer, and Pregnancy-induced hypertension status was considered if systolic blood pressure was ≥ 140 mmHg and/or diastolic blood pressure ≥90 mmHg on two measurements among pregnant women with gestational age > 20 weeks. Factors associated with Pregnancy-induced hypertension were identified by multivariable binary logistic regression analysis, as expressed by adjusted odds ratio (aOR) and its 95% confidence interval. Results The mean age of the participants was 29.4 years (SD = ±4.6), and the majority of women were multiparous (59.6%). The prevalence of Pregnancy-induced hypertension was 13.4% (95% CI: 10.2% – 16.9%), of which 81% were preeclampsia. In the multivariable analysis, PIH was associated with, the poorest wealth index (aOR = 0.26, 95%CI: 0.08–0.90), having a family history of hypertension (aOR = 12.52,95%CI: 4.52–34.62), overweight maternal BMI (aOR = 4.24, 95%CI: 2.06–8.72), and gestational age (aOR = 0.21 at 95% CI: 0.06–0.82). Conclusions More than 13 out of 100 pregnant women were found to have pregnancy-induced hypertension in the Hadiya zone, Southern Ethiopia. The high prevalence of Pregnancy-induced hypertension and its association with wealth index, gestational age, overweight/obesity and family history of hypertension/Pregnancy-induced hypertension underscores the need for targeted, tailored, and contextualized interventions to address Pregnancy-induced hypertension in the Hadiya zone. Creating awareness on Pregnancy-induced hypertension among pregnant women and the general population and enhancing early screening and detection services in the community and healthcare facilities need to be strengthened in the Hadiya zone.

Abdominal organ injury in cardiac arrest: Systematic literature review

PLoS ONE Bjørn Hoftun Farbu, Jostein Hagemo, Marius Rehn Aug 01, 2025 DOI: 10.1371/journal.pone.0329164

Background Both cardiopulmonary resuscitation (CPR) and ischaemia could lead to abdominal organ injury. However, the importance of abdominal injury in cardiac arrest remains uncertain. We aimed to systematically review indexed literature to describe incidence of abdominal injury after non-traumatic cardiac arrest and associations with outcome. Methods We searched MEDLINE/PubMed, Embase, The Cochrane Database of Systematic Reviews and Scopus up to 12th September 2024 for studies reporting differences in outcomes between patients with and without abdominal injury, and all studies reporting abdominal adverse events after cardiac arrest. Two independent reviewers screened articles for eligibility. One reviewer extracted data and assessed risk of bias using the Critical Appraisal Skills Programme checklist. Injuries were defined as traumatic or ischaemic, either in the studies or otherwise by the reviewers. Results were summarized and presented in tables and Forest plots. We followed the PRISMA guidelines, and registered the study in PROSPERO. Results We included 68 studies and 140 case reports. Most studies were single-centre. Quantitative synthesis of evidence was not feasible given high heterogeneity and risk of bias. Traumatic injuries affected mostly liver and spleen, with incidences from 0% to 15%, reaching 29% in one study of mechanical chest compressions. Life-threatening injuries were uncommon. The incidence of ischaemic injury was dependent on assessment method; 7% to 28% had liver injury, 0.7% to 2.5% was diagnosed with non-occlusive mesenteric ischaemia, 82% to 100% had intestinal injury measured by biomarkers. Ischaemic injuries were associated with mortality. Conclusion In this comprehensive review of abdominal injuries following cardiac arrest, CPR-related traumatic injuries were uncommon, but should be considered in patients with unexplained clinical deterioration. Ischaemic injury incidence ranged from 0.7% to 100%, and was consistently associated with mortality. Whether abdominal ischaemia independently contributes to poor outcomes remains unresolved and warrants further investigation. PROSPERO ID: CRD42022311508.

Monetary policy, debt maturity structure and corporate investment efficiency: Evidence from China

PLoS ONE Liping Zheng, Guangzhen Liu, Ziwei Liang et al. Aug 01, 2025 DOI: 10.1371/journal.pone.0328358

This paper examines the impact of monetary policy on corporate investment efficiency from the perspective of debt maturity structure by selecting data on Chinese non-financial listed firms and Chinese macroeconomic data from 2007–2022. The results find that loose monetary policy can have a dual effect on corporate investment efficiency by extending corporate debt maturity structure, which is manifested in alleviating corporate under-investment and promoting corporate over-investment. Heterogeneity analysis shows that in high bank competition areas, the debt maturity structure effect of monetary policy is effective in mitigating under-investment and promoting over-investment by enterprises. In contrast, in low bank competition regions, the debt maturity structure effect of monetary policy promotes corporate over-investment but has no significant effect on corporate under-investment. In addition, the debt maturity structure effect of monetary policy can effectively alleviate under-investment and promote over-investment of enterprises with low financing constraints. And it has no significant effect on the under-investment and over-investment behavior of high financing constraint enterprises. The research in this paper reveals the specific mechanism of monetary policy affecting the investment efficiency of enterprises, which has certain reference value for the objective evaluation of monetary policy effects.

Analytical validation and sequencing coverage studies suggest that performance of a liquid biopsy assay is tumor agnostic (DNA-is-DNA)

PLoS ONE Wei Meng, Russell Petry, Norberto Pantoja Galicia et al. Aug 01, 2025 DOI: 10.1371/journal.pone.0329392

Per regulatory and standard requirements (e.g., Clinical & Laboratory Standards Institute (CLSI) guidelines, United States Food and Drug Administration (FDA) correspondence), analytical validation (AV) for each companion diagnostic (CDx) biomarker should be repeated using a clinical sample set for each cancer type listed as an indication in labelling for a CDx. Using data from AV studies and Foundation Medicine (FMI)’s clinical database, we evaluated the hypothesis that analytical performance of the FoundationOne®Liquid CDx (F1LCDx) assay is not impacted by cancer type and that large sets of clinical, tumor-specific samples might not be necessary for analytical validation of specific CDx biomarkers. We retrospectively evaluated all liquid biopsy samples from F1LCDx assay AV studies that were executed between April 2019 and November 2021 and clinical samples processed by F1LCDx between September 2020 and October 2021. For the samples from AV studies, we evaluated the precision and concordance performance by F1LCDx between tumor types; and for the clinical samples, we performed analyses comparing the distribution of coverage between tumor types. A total of 31,247 F1LCDx clinical samples and 579 samples from F1LCDx AV studies with a total of 335 disease ontologies (DOs) were included in this study. For precision: the median absolute pairwise difference of mean reproducibility between any pairs of two tumor types is 0.94% [0.01%−2.63%] and the median absolute pairwise difference of mean repeatability between any pairs of two tumor types is 0.91% [0.03%−2.98%]. For concordance: the median absolute ∂PPA between any pairs of two tumor types is 1.39% [0.1%−4.1%] and the median absolute ∂NPA between any pairs of two tumor types is 0.05% [0%−1%]. For coverage, a similar distribution was observed between tumor types using F1LCDx clinical samples. Herein, the results based on the extensive cohort of 31,826 liquid biopsy samples sequenced by the F1LCDx assay demonstrated that both analytical assessment of precision and concordance and coverage are comparable among tumor types (i.e., deoxyribonucleic acid (DNA) is DNA). The tumor type that circulating tumor DNA (ctDNA) was derived from is therefore not a vital consideration for AV studies for F1LCDx assay.

LTR-Net: A deep learning-based approach for financial data prediction and risk evaluation in enterprises

PLoS ONE Shimiao Liu Aug 01, 2025 DOI: 10.1371/journal.pone.0328013

Financial data prediction and risk assessment represent a complex multi-task problem that requires effective handling of time-series data and multi-dimensional features. Traditional models struggle to simultaneously capture temporal dependencies, global information, and intricate nonlinear relationships, resulting in limited prediction accuracy. To address this challenge, we propose LTR-Net, a multi-module deep learning model that combines LSTM, Transformer, and ResNet. LTR-Net effectively processes the multi-dimensional features and dynamic changes in financial data by incorporating a temporal dependency modeling module, a global information capture module, and a deep feature extraction module. Experimental results demonstrate that LTR-Net significantly outperforms existing mainstream models, including LSTM, GRU, Transformer, and DeepAR, across multiple financial datasets. On the Kaggle Financial Distress Prediction Dataset and the Yahoo Finance Stock Market Data, LTR-Net exhibits higher accuracy, stability, and robustness across various metrics such as MSE, RMSE, MAE, and AUC. Ablation experiments further validate the indispensability of each module within LTR-Net, confirming the pivotal roles of the LSTM, Transformer, and ResNet modules in financial data analysis. LTR-Net not only enhances the accuracy of financial data prediction but also exhibits strong generalization capabilities, making it adaptable to data analysis and risk assessment tasks in other domains.

Long lasting effects of perinatal exposure to the Chlorpyrifos pesticide on sleep, breathing, and neuroinflammation in adult mice

PLoS ONE Elena Miglioranza, Laura Rullo, Sara Alvente et al. Aug 01, 2025 DOI: 10.1371/journal.pone.0328581

Early-life exposure to environmental stressors may increase the risk of disease later in life. Chlorpyrifos (CPF), a widely used pesticide and acetylcholinesterase inhibitor, can cross the placental barrier and can be found in breast milk, leading to excessive cholinergic stimulation. Acetylcholine is involved in sleep and respiratory regulation. The main objective of this study was to investigate whether perinatal CPF exposure affects sleep-related breathing together with promotion of neuroinflammatory processes in adulthood. To explore these effects, CPF (5 mg/kg/day) or vehicle was administered orally to dams from mating to weaning. The offspring were not directly treated. At 17–18 weeks of age, male and female offspring underwent electroencephalographic and electromyographic electrode implantation to monitor sleep-wake cycles. Recordings were conducted over 48 hours in home cages, and for 7 hours in a plethysmographic chamber to assess sleep-related breathing pattern. At the end of recordings, hippocampal tissues were collected for gene expression analysis via real-time PCR. Results revealed that CPF perinatal exposure increased sighs and apneas during sleep in adult mice, especially in female. Additionally, expression of pro-inflammatory cytokines was upregulated while expression of peroxisome proliferator-activated receptor genes was downregulated in the hippocampus of female mice born to CPF-treated dams. These findings suggest that perinatal CPF exposure can induce long-lasting alterations in sleep-related respiratory patterns and hippocampal inflammatory responses, with a sex-specific susceptibility—females being more affected. This highlights the perinatal period as a critical window of vulnerability to environmental toxicants such as pesticides. The results support the hypothesis that adult sleep and brain inflammation phenotypes may be modulated by early-life chemical exposures during pregnancy and lactation.

Mental and physical health of US rural/urban caregivers of persons with dementia

PLoS ONE Phoebe Tran, Fei Wang, E-Shien Chang Aug 01, 2025 DOI: 10.1371/journal.pone.0329260

Purpose Increased dependence on caregiving and limited access to healthcare services in rural US communities may contribute to worse mental and physical health in rural caregivers of persons with dementia (PWD) relative to their urban counterparts. We assessed the association between rural/urban residence and mental and physical health among US caregivers of PWD. Methods Using 2020–2022 Behavioral Risk Factor Surveillance System data, we identified caregivers of PWD from rural (n = 2311) and urban (n = 15094) areas. Mental health outcome was operationalized as poor mental health days (PMHD); categorized as 0, 1–13, and ≥14 PMHD in previous month. Poor physical health (PPHD) was operationalized in the same manner. Covariates included socio-demographic and caregiving factors. Four sets of unadjusted and adjusted survey-weighted multinomial logistic models (reference: 0 days) were created for PMHD and PPHD. Results Approximately, 25.7% of rural and 20.8% of urban caregivers reported ≥14 PMHD while 25% of rural and 10% of urban caregivers reported ≥14 PPHD. Prior to adjustment, rural caregivers had lower odds (0.59, 95% CI: 0.34–1.05) of 1–13 vs. 0 PMHD but higher odds (1.13, 95% CI: 0.55–2.30) of 14 + vs 0 PMHD compared to urban caregivers with neither association being statistically significant. In adjusted models, the association for 1–13 vs 0 PMHD became significant, while rural residence became associated with lower, non-significant odds of 14 + vs. 0 PMHD. For physical health, rural caregivers had lower odds (0.86, 95% CI: 0.53–1.41) of 1–13 vs 0 PPHD but higher odds (2.57, 95% CI: 1.00–6.63) of 14 + vs 0 PPHD in unadjusted models with neither result being significant. After adjustment, the associations for 1–13 vs. 0 PPHD were attenuated and remained non-significant, while rural caregivers had significantly higher odds of 14 + vs 0 PPHD, consistent with unadjusted results. Conclusions Rural caregivers of PWD are less likely to experience short-term mental health problems compared to their urban counterparts. However, they face similar levels of experiencing PMHD. Additionally, rural caregivers of PWD are more likely to endure more PPHD than urban caregivers. Considering the extensive day-to-day responsibilities that caregivers of PWD carry and the ongoing need for their support, it is crucial to enhance long-term mental health resources for both rural and urban caregivers. Furthermore, targeted initiatives to support the long-term physical health of rural caregivers are equally essential.
